Step 1 — Define the Scope Before Anything Else
Why Scope Definition Prevents Costly Mid-Project Changes
The biggest mistake homeowners make is starting construction before the full scope is locked in. A change mid-project — moving a wall, adding a bathroom, upgrading finishes — multiplies costs and delays timelines.
It is important to walk through every room of the home and document exactly what needs to change. Layout reconfigurations, kitchen upgrades, bathroom renovations, flooring replacement, electrical updates, plumbing changes — all of it goes into one master scope document before a single quote is requested.
A comprehensive scope protects the homeowner at every stage of the project. It becomes the basis of the contract, the permit applications, and the project timeline.
Step 2 — Understand Austin’s Permitting Requirements
What Permits Are Required for a Full Home Renovation in Austin?
Austin follows the 2024 International Residential Code with local amendments. Any project involving structural changes, plumbing relocation, electrical upgrades, or HVAC modifications requires permits from the City of Austin Development Services Department.
Structural wall removal, open-concept conversions, bathroom additions, and room expansions all fall under permitting requirements. Cosmetic work — interior painting, flooring replacement without structural change, hardware swaps — typically does not.
It is critical to confirm permit requirements before construction begins. Unpermitted work creates serious problems at the time of home sale, insurance claim, or refinancing. A qualified remodeling team handles the full permit process on the homeowner’s behalf.

Step 3 — Build a Realistic Timeline
How Long Does a Full Home Remodel Take in Austin?
A full home renovation in Austin typically runs 4 to 12 months depending on scope. Design and planning takes 4 to 8 weeks. Permit approval adds another 3 to 6 weeks. Construction runs from several months to nearly a year for larger projects.
The key to staying on schedule is hiring a team with a dedicated project manager who coordinates all trades, manages material deliveries, and resolves issues before they cascade into delays. A milestone-based timeline agreed upon before construction begins gives homeowners clear expectations at every stage.
It is important to build a contingency buffer into both the timeline and the budget. Discoveries inside walls — old wiring, moisture damage, foundation issues — are common in Austin’s older neighborhoods and they affect both schedule and budget.
Step 4 — Choose the Right Full Home Remodeling Team
What Should Homeowners Look for in a Whole Home Renovation Contractor?
A full home renovation demands more than a general handyman or a single-trade contractor. It requires a full-service, design-build team that manages every phase — structural planning, design, permits, construction, and finish work — under one roof.
Homeowners should verify licensing and insurance, ask for references from past whole-home renovation clients, and review a portfolio of completed full-home projects before signing a contract. A vague estimate is a red flag. A detailed, itemized written contract is non-negotiable.
